This page documents the service account used by the Cartwheel load-testing rig against the Fernmarket checkout flow. The account is scoped to the staging environment only, with permissions limited to cart creation, payment simulation, and order teardown; it cannot read customer records or touch production queues. Test runs are rate-capped at 500 synthetic checkouts per minute and logged to the Cartwheel audit stream for review. The rig authenticates to the internal checkout gateway using the service key recorded below.

service key, yadug-bajog: zpat3_pou

## Versioning the Copperquill shared component library

Releases follow strict semver; breaking visual changes bump the major version and require a migration note in the ledger. The publish job tags the commit, builds the package, and pushes to the Ferngate registry. Publishing only succeeds when the registry credential is present, which the following line provides.

sealed setting: ARCHIVE_KEY3=8d0

Fabletree test-data factory: if seed jobs hang, restart the generator pod and check the schema pin in factory.lock. Do not regenerate fixtures mid-run; partial batches corrupt downstream snapshots. Truncate the staging tables first, then rerun with --resume. The generator pulls anonymized templates from the Corvid vault service, which rejects unauthenticated pulls. Its credential must be set in the pod's .env on the line that follows.

vault entry, yahif-yajep: COURIER_KEY29=b802bdf8034096b65a51c6ba5abe2

- [ ] **Step 7: Breaker override escrow.** After sealing the signing keys for the Tallgrove upstream API circuit breaker, confirm the support team can force the breaker open during a full outage. The override bundle lives in the sealed escrow drawer and is useless without its unlock phrase. Two ceremony witnesses must initial this step before proceeding. The escrow bundle is decrypted with the recovery passphrase that follows.

vault phrase of kahip-kahop = holath-quenmir